A Graduate Certificate in Remote Work Ergonomics Research provides specialized training in assessing and mitigating ergonomic risks within remote work environments. This program equips professionals with the knowledge and skills needed to design, implement, and evaluate effective ergonomic interventions for remote workers, addressing musculoskeletal disorders and enhancing overall well-being.
Learning outcomes include a deep understanding of ergonomic principles as applied to remote work setups, proficiency in conducting ergonomic assessments using various tools and methodologies, and the ability to develop and present data-driven recommendations for improving remote workspaces. Students will also master relevant research methods for studying remote work ergonomics.
The typical duration for such a certificate program ranges from six to twelve months, depending on the institution and program intensity. The program often involves a blend of online coursework, practical exercises, and potentially an applied research project, allowing for flexible learning tailored to professionals' schedules.
